Sir John Sinclair has the honor of presenting his best compliments; and in compliance with the directions of the Bye-laws, subjoins those sections of the 3d, 4th, and 6th statutes, which are proposed to be reconsidered on Tuesday March 17, 1795. The favour of your attendance is particularly requested, as no alteration can be made in any of the Bye-laws, unless sixteen members are present:
